/********************** FILE HEADER **********************/
26
 
27
struct external_filehdr
28
  {
29
    char f_magic[2];	/* magic number			*/
30
    char f_nscns[2];	/* number of sections		*/
31
    char f_timdat[4];	/* time & date stamp		*/
32
    char f_symptr[4];	/* file pointer to symtab	*/
33
    char f_nsyms[4];	/* number of symtab entries	*/
34
    char f_opthdr[2];	/* sizeof(optional hdr)		*/
35
    char f_flags[2];	/* flags			*/
36
    char f_target_id[2];/* target id (TIc80 specific)	*/
37
};
38
 
39
#define	TIC80_ARCH_MAGIC	0x0C1	/* Goes in the file header magic number field */
40
#define TIC80_TARGET_ID		0x95	/* Goes in the target id field */
41
 
42
#define TIC80BADMAG(x) ((x).f_magic != TIC80_ARCH_MAGIC)
43
 
44
#define	FILHDR	struct external_filehdr
45
#define	FILHSZ	22
46
 
47
#define TIC80_AOUTHDR_MAGIC	0x108	/* Goes in the optional file header magic number field */
48

/********************** SECTION HEADER **********************/
50
 
51
struct external_scnhdr
52
{
53
	char		s_name[8];	/* section name			*/
54
	char		s_paddr[4];	/* physical address, aliased s_nlib */
55
	char		s_vaddr[4];	/* virtual address		*/
56
	char		s_size[4];	/* section size			*/
57
	char		s_scnptr[4];	/* file ptr to raw data for section */
58
	char		s_relptr[4];	/* file ptr to relocation	*/
59
	char		s_lnnoptr[4];	/* file ptr to line numbers	*/
60
	char		s_nreloc[2];	/* number of relocation entries	*/
61
	char		s_nlnno[2];	/* number of line number entries*/
62
	char		s_flags[2];	/* flags			*/
63
	char		s_reserved[1];	/* reserved (TIc80 specific)	*/
64
	char		s_mempage[1];	/* memory page number (TIc80)	*/
65
};
66
 
67
/* Names of "special" sections.  */
68
#define _TEXT	".text"
69
#define _DATA	".data"
70
#define _BSS	".bss"
71
#define _CINIT	".cinit"
72
#define _CONST	".const"
73
#define _SWITCH	".switch"
74
#define _STACK	".stack"
75
#define _SYSMEM	".sysmem"
76
 
77
#define	SCNHDR	struct external_scnhdr
78
#define	SCNHSZ	40
79

/********************** RELOCATION DIRECTIVES **********************/
84
 
85
/* The external reloc has an offset field, because some of the reloc
86
   types on the h8 don't have room in the instruction for the entire
87
   offset - eg the strange jump and high page addressing modes.  */
88
 
89
struct external_reloc
90
{
91
  char r_vaddr[4];
92
  char r_symndx[4];
93
  char r_reserved[2];
94
  char r_type[2];
95
};
96
 
97
#define RELOC struct external_reloc
98
#define RELSZ 12
99
 
100
/* TIc80 relocation types. */
101
 
102
#define R_ABS		0x00		/* Absolute address - no relocation */
103
#define R_RELLONGX	0x11		/* PP: 32 bits, direct */
104
#define R_PPBASE	0x34		/* PP: Global base address type */
105
#define R_PPLBASE	0x35		/* PP: Local base address type */
106
#define R_PP15		0x38		/* PP: Global 15 bit offset */
107
#define R_PP15W		0x39		/* PP: Global 15 bit offset divided by 4 */
108
#define R_PP15H		0x3A		/* PP: Global 15 bit offset divided by 2 */
109
#define R_PP16B		0x3B		/* PP: Global 16 bit offset for bytes */
110
#define R_PPL15		0x3C		/* PP: Local 15 bit offset */
111
#define R_PPL15W	0x3D		/* PP: Local 15 bit offset divided by 4 */
112
#define R_PPL15H	0x3E		/* PP: Local 15 bit offset divided by 2 */
113
#define R_PPL16B	0x3F		/* PP: Local 16 bit offset for bytes */
114
#define R_PPN15		0x40		/* PP: Global 15 bit negative offset */
115
#define R_PPN15W	0x41		/* PP: Global 15 bit negative offset divided by 4 */
116
#define R_PPN15H	0x42		/* PP: Global 15 bit negative offset divided by 2 */
117
#define R_PPN16B	0x43		/* PP: Global 16 bit negative byte offset */
118
#define R_PPLN15	0x44		/* PP: Local 15 bit negative offset */
119
#define R_PPLN15W	0x45		/* PP: Local 15 bit negative offset divided by 4 */
120
#define R_PPLN15H	0x46		/* PP: Local 15 bit negative offset divided by 2 */
121
#define R_PPLN16B	0x47		/* PP: Local 16 bit negative byte offset */
122
#define R_MPPCR15W	0x4E		/* MP: 15 bit PC-relative divided by 4 */
123
#define R_MPPCR		0x4F		/* MP: 32 bit PC-relative divided by 4 */
